I'm sure a lot of you remember when Ford made plans back in '88 for the Mustang to become a front wheel drive Mazda Mustang. It was supposed to be phased out by '92 and replaced with what became the Ford Probe.

Thank God it didn't because look what became of the Probe. Looks like they decided to try it again. Only this time they succeeded in the form our beloved 2005 Ford (Mazda) Mustang. I realize most of this information was known before the cars even came out, but while decoding my VIN for another thread, I came across some interesting little facts.


Here's what some of the numbers represent.

1st, 2nd, & 3rd: 1ZV = Vehicle Manufacturer: Automotive Alliance International (USA)
(NOTE: Not Ford. All the other codes are Ford Motor Company)

5th: T = Passenger Car Identifier: All passenger cars imported from outside North America or non-Ford built passenger cars marketed by Ford.
(NOTE: Must be why the ERL always said our cars were "Released from foreign assembly plant..." Obviously the Mustang gets this code because it's built at a Mazda plant)

11th: 5 = Vehicle Assembly Plant: AAI, Flat Rock, MI
(NOTE:AAI's the only one with a number here. All other Ford's have a letter. Must be a Mazda thing.)

2005 VIN Guide


Technically Ford is calling it a Mazda. OK. They got one over on me. I still love the car. Way to go, Fo.. err Mazda!
